ArduinoCore-avr-master安装
时间: 2023-05-30 14:06:16 浏览: 38
ArduinoCore-avr是Arduino IDE使用的AVR微控制器的核心库。安装ArduinoCore-avr-master需要以下步骤:
1. 下载ArduinoCore-avr-master的压缩包。可以从Github上下载。
2. 解压缩压缩包。
3. 找到Arduino IDE的安装路径。在Windows上,一般是C:\Program Files (x86)\Arduino。
4. 进入Arduino IDE的安装路径下的hardware文件夹。
5. 在hardware文件夹中创建一个新文件夹,命名为“avr”。
6. 进入avr文件夹。
7. 将解压缩的ArduinoCore-avr-master文件夹复制到avr文件夹中。
8. 重启Arduino IDE。
完成以上步骤后,Arduino IDE会使用ArduinoCore-avr-master作为AVR微控制器的核心库。
相关问题
rsync -avr
`rsync -avr` 是 rsync 命令的一种常用选项组合,用于执行递归同步操作并保持文件的权限和时间戳。
- `-a, --archive` 选项是 rsync 的归档模式,它会递归地复制文件,保持文件属性(权限、所有者等)、符号链接、设备文件等,并且会保持原始文件的时间戳。
- `-v, --verbose` 选项会输出详细的操作日志,显示哪些文件被复制。
综合起来,`rsync -avr` 命令将会递归地同步文件并保持它们的属性和时间戳,并且提供详细的操作日志。
请注意,这只是 `rsync` 命令的一种常见用法,实际使用时可能需要根据具体需求进行调整。
sdi-12 uart avr
SDI-12是一种数字接口协议,用于环境监测领域中的数据采集。它是一种串行数据接口,采用12位数据帧格式进行通信。SDI-12协议允许在一个总线上连接多个传感器或设备,并使用单线通信传送数据。
UART是通用异步收发器的缩写,是一种在计算机硬件中常见的串行通信接口。它用于将数据以二进制形式在计算机和外部设备之间进行传输。AVR则是指Atmel公司生产的一类微控制器,它们使用UART作为与其他设备进行通信的一种标准接口。
在SDI-12与UART和AVR结合使用的场景中,我们可以使用AVR微控制器作为主控制器,通过UART接口与SDI-12传感器进行通信。AVR通过UART发送命令和接收数据,然后将数据进行处理和存储,以便后续使用。
通过SDI-12传感器可以测量环境中的诸多参数,比如温度、湿度、PH值、土壤湿度等。AVR可以通过UART与传感器通信,控制传感器进行测量,并将测量结果发送回主控制器进行处理。
总而言之,SDI-12是一种用于环境监测领域数据采集的协议,UART是一种常见的串行通信接口,而AVR是一类微控制器。在实际应用中,我们可以使用UART接口和AVR微控制器与SDI-12传感器进行通信,实现环境参数的测量与监控。